/**
 * Container for the parameters to the {@link com.amazonaws.services.ec2.AmazonEC2#describeSnapshots(DescribeSnapshotsRequest) DescribeSnapshots operation}.
 * 

* Describes one or more of the Amazon EBS snapshots available to you. * Available snapshots include public snapshots available for any AWS * account to launch, private snapshots that you own, and private * snapshots owned by another AWS account but for which you've been given * explicit create volume permissions. *

*

* The create volume permissions fall into the following categories: *

* *
    *
  • public : The owner of the snapshot granted create volume * permissions for the snapshot to the all group. All AWS * accounts have create volume permissions for these snapshots.
  • *
  • explicit : The owner of the snapshot granted create * volume permissions to a specific AWS account.
  • *
  • implicit : An AWS account has implicit create volume * permissions for all snapshots it owns.
  • * *
*

* The list of snapshots returned can be modified by specifying snapshot * IDs, snapshot owners, or AWS accounts with create volume permissions. * If no options are specified, Amazon EC2 returns all snapshots for * which you have create volume permissions. *

*

* If you specify one or more snapshot IDs, only snapshots that have the * specified IDs are returned. If you specify an invalid snapshot ID, an * error is returned. If you specify a snapshot ID for which you do not * have access, it is not included in the returned results. *

*

* If you specify one or more snapshot owners, only snapshots from the * specified owners and for which you have access are returned. The * results can include the AWS account IDs of the specified owners, * amazon for snapshots owned by Amazon, or * self for snapshots that you own. *

*

* If you specify a list of restorable users, only snapshots with create * snapshot permissions for those users are returned. You can specify AWS * account IDs (if you own the snapshots), self for * snapshots for which you own or have explicit permissions, or * all for public snapshots. *

*
